Chiyaan Vikram's Kadaram Kondan, which was directed by Rajesh M Selva, was jointly produced by Kamal Haasan's Raaj Kamal Films International in association with R Ravindran's Trident Arts. The movie hit the screens last year on 19th July and got a very good opening and the reception for the movie was as good as expected. This movie, which had Vikram in the lead, also saw Akshara Haasan and Abi Hassan, in vital roles. Abi Hassan, veteran actor Nassar's son, made his acting debut with this movie.

Kadaram Kondan was a unique experience as a whole due to the multi-cultural people who formed the cast. Rajesh mentioned that there were people from France, Malaysians, Malaysian Tamilians, also people from Mumbai, Hyderabad and Kerala. Rajesh told that getting the 45-member multi-cultural crew was indeed challenging and attributed that to the movie's success.
